* A blood drive will be held Friday, May 28, from 2:30 to 7:45 p.m. at the Southold Town Recreation Center on Peconic Lane. Donors must be between the ages of 17 and 76, in good health and weigh at least 110 pounds. A photo or signature ID and your Social Security number will be required for donation. Call Louise Egert at 477-1273.

* Jean Hughes of Greenport has been named employee of the month for May at San Simeon by the Sound Center for Nursing and Rehabilitation. She has been the breakfast cook for San Simeon, where she begins her day at 5 a.m. and often receives notes from residents on their place mats complimenting her on the meal. For Ms. Hughes, San Simeon is a family affair. Her mother is a nurse’s aide, her son, a dietary aide and her grandmother is a San Simeon resident. Ms. Hughes has worked at San Simeon for 13 years and has been selected employee of the month three times.

* Eastern Long Island Hospital’s Golf Classic at Gardiner’s Bay Country Club on Shelter Island is scheduled for Wednesday, June 9. Lunch gets under way at 11:30 a.m. with tee-off at 1 p.m. The patio grill barbecue will run from 2 to 5 p.m. Cocktails are at 5:30 p.m., followed by a buffet dinner at 6 and the awards ceremony honoring Dr. Frank Adipietro at 7 p.m. Dr. Adipietro is medical staff president, vice chairman of the hospital’s board of trustees and director of the interventional pain management center. Call 477-5164.
